I had a hate/love relationship with Project 365. At the start, I knew I was going to be forcing myself to take pictures on some days, but I didn’t know that it would happen so often. If you look through the pictures, you can really tell which ones I actually wanted to take, and which ones I hurriedly snapped at 11:59 PM.
I don’t think I necessarily became a better photographer. I didn’t really teach myself any different techniques but I did experiment more. I didn’t teach myself how to properly use different equipment but I did find out more about what kind of pictures I like to take and I did notice a pattern in how I like to post-process them afterwards. I know more about what inspires me and what, to me, makes a good photograph.
…Okay never mind, I guess I did get better in some ways.
I had no doubt about following through with it. I know I can discipline myself and I knew I was going to stay committed even if at some points I didn’t feel like it was doing anything for me. I probably won’t do it again, but I’d say try it if you haven’t. I mean, it’s only 365 366 pictures, right?
